Marshmallow Easter Bars

Description

Delightful Marshmallow Easter Bars featuring silky white chocolate, soft mini marshmallows, and crunchy Sixlets – perfect for spring celebrations!


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 1/2 cups white chocolate chips or candy melts
  • 1 tablespoon shortening (only if using chocolate chips)
  • 3 1/2 cups mini marshmallows
  • 4.5 oz Sixlets in Easter colors

Instructions

  1. Line an 8×8 baking dish with parchment and set it aside.
  2. Melt the white chocolate in a heat-safe bowl over barely simmering water.
  3. Stir continuously until smooth and lump-free. If using chocolate chips, add the shortening.
  4. Remove from heat and cool for 1–2 minutes.
  5. Add mini marshmallows and half the Sixlets to the chocolate. Stir gently to coat.
  6. Transfer the mixture to the prepared pan and spread evenly.
  7. Scatter remaining Sixlets over the top and press lightly.
  8. Freeze for 20 minutes to firm up.
  9. Cut into squares and serve or store.

Notes

Can be made up to 2 weeks in advance and stored in an airtight container in the freezer. Thaw before serving.
